Transaction 214a73c38e17222406dff521e5b5d61d879c427ac528f7bd2c52cd05c5094b25
1 Input
1 Output
-
214a73c38e17222406dff521e5b5d61d879c427ac528f7bd2c52cd05c5094b25:0
- value
- 8978811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375854d5bb0799bc48c8a71de213fe17278fa OP_EQUAL
- address
- 3BMEXX21X5Xzbhg1yj1zuxuNmXDJwahRKg